Tone
1-2 Unsatisfactory
Tone often NOT FOCUSED, CLEAR OR CENTERED. Tone DOES NOT BLEND WELL with others.
3-4 Developing
Tone is focused but OFTEN UNCONTROLLED in normal singing. Tone PROBABLY WILL NOT BLEND WELL with others. FREQUENTLY THE TONE QUALITY DETRACTS from performance.
5-6 Proficient
Tone is MORE OFTEN FOCUSED, CLEAR, and CENTERED. Tone will PROBABLY BLEND WELL with others. Occasionally the TONE QUALITY WILL DETRACT from overall performance.
7-8 Distinguished
Tone is FOCUSED, CLEAR and CENTERED. Tone BLENDS WELL with others.
9-10 Exceptoinal
Tone is CONSISTENLY focused, clear and centered. Tone WILL BLEND WELL with others.
Pitch Awareness
1-2 Unsatisfactory
VERY FEW ACCURATE or secure pitches.
3-4 Developing
Some accurate pitches, but there are FREQUENT and/OR REPEATD ERRORS OR SCOOPING.
5-6 Proficient
More accurate pitches but still a FEW ERRORS OR SCOOPING.
7-8 Distinguished
AN OCCASIONAL ISOLATED ERROR but most of the time pitch is accurate and secure.
9-10 Exceptoinal
Sings on pitch consistently. Pitch is ACCURATE AND SECURE.
Diction
1-2 Unsatisfactory
Very awkward diction. Words came across as MUMBLED OR SLURRED.
3-4 Developing
Words were GENERALLY UNDERSTANDABLE but sung in an AWKWARD manner. VOWEL SHAPE WAS NOT APPROPRIATE.
5-6 Proficient
Fairly good diction. OCCASIONALLY words were pronounced with AWKWARD CONSONANTS OR VOWEL SHAPES. DICTION FREQUENTLY DETRACTED from performance.
7-8 Distinguished
Generally good diction. MOST WORDS WERE PRONOUNCED CLEARLY. DICTION DOES NOT DISTRACT from performance.
9-10 Exceptoinal
Very beautiful diction. ALL WORDS PRONOUNCED CLEARLY, and vowels were always shaped appropriately.
